Transaction 28830ee632685df377a63acc25f6d15e5076736548690b57724beda7be19acf3
1 Input
1 Output
-
28830ee632685df377a63acc25f6d15e5076736548690b57724beda7be19acf3:0
- value
- 8600953
- script pubkey
- OP_0 OP_PUSHBYTES_20 2d8bf9269a4a12d5a5d550904be73baa9562e20a
- address
- bc1q9k9ljf56fgfdtfw42zgyheem422k9cs28k4dex